New Delhi: O Bikram Singh and Ch Rameshwori Devi will lead the Indian charge in men`s and women`s section respectively when a 15-member cycling squad take part in the cycling competition in next month`s Asian Games to be held in Guangzhou, China.
The Cycling Federation of India (CFI) today picked the squad for the November 12-27 mega-event. The Indian squad includes nine men and six woman cyclists. Besides Bikram, who had claimed a bronze in the Asian Cup earlier this year, the Indian hopes will also lie on Amrit Singh, Vinod Malik and Atul Kumar. Among the Indian eves, Mahita Mohan is expected to spring a few surprises. India`s foreign coach Grahm Seers and head coach Chayan Choudhary, along with woman trainer Ruma Chatopahya, will accompany the riders during the Games. Training camp for the cyclists will commence here from October 27. Earlier, a 27-member Indian squad had failed to make any impact in the October 3-14 Commonwealth Games here. The squad: Men: O Bikram Singh, Dayala Ram Saran, Satbir Singh, Sombir, Vinod Malik, Atul Kumar, Amrit Singh, Prince HS Hylen, Rajender Bishoni; Women: Ch Rameshwori Devi, Y Sunita Devi, Pana Chowdury, Rejani V, Mahita Mohan, Suchitra Devi. Coaches: Grahm Seers, Chayan Choudary, Ruma Chatopahya. PTI
